Our Engaging, Enabling Environment 

At St Jude’s, our Reception isn’t just a classroom; it’s a portal to wonder designed through the eyes of the child. Following the visionary approach of Greg Bottrill, we’ve traded traditional "areas" for immersive landscapes of imagination.

In Number Land, mathematics becomes a lived story of patterns and discovery, while Adventure Island transforms construction into a daring quest of engineering and story telling. By listening to the "Drawing Club" of their minds, we ensure our environment evolves alongside child interests and seasonal topics.

Embracing the Hygge philosophy, we’ve curated a calm, natural aesthetic. Gone is the overstimulating neon of old; in its place are soft textures, foliage, and neutral tones that allow the children’s vibrant ideas to take center stage. This serene backdrop provides the emotional safety our children need to take risks. It is an enabling space where magic is captured, curiosity is celebrated, and every child feels truly seen.
